Intersected Arc from Inscribed Angle (Level 1)

This math topic focuses on finding the lengths of intersected arcs from given inscribed angles in circles. It includes multiple problems where students use knowledge from geometry to determine the measurement of the arc corresponding to a specified inscribed angle. Each question presents a different circle configuration and requires the application of the theoretical principles of circle geometry concerning arcs and angles.
